The Critical Nature of Immigrant Talent In the Intelligent Age

 

  1. We are living in what has been dubbed “The Intelligent Age,” a time of unprecedented acceleration of new intelligence, including AI and other emerging technologies that are fueling every aspect of infrastructure and invention in our universe, and transforming our lives, security, and society daily
  2. To capture the momentum of this transformation, we need to marshal the skills and capabilities of the brightest minds in science, technology, mathematics, and engineering, as well as the most agile leadership
  3. Yet our developed economies are facing the most limited pool of talent to date, as population rates are declining.  In the US, we know that as of this year, any surge in labor will depend fully on immigrant talent.
  4. The equation is unequivocal – absent invitation and influx of immigrant students, scientists, engineers, and executives, we will not even be able to maintain continuity of labor, much less expand and adapt to the new age of intelligence development.
  5. And our foundational social security and tax revenues will be eroded absent their entry.
  6. The political debate remains focused on a fairly antiquated zero-sum view of migration – each immigrant that enters takes a job away from an American.  That analysis fails to evaluate the reality of the supply curve, which expands as more immigrants with talent enter the job zones – they innovate and expand the job pool.
  7. The better question to focus on is how to channel migration to optimize the entry of the talent we most need.
